The engine is the part of the vehicle that keeps it in motion. It is composed
of several components in order for it to function normally; one of which is the
crankshaft. The crankshaft is the part of the engine that turns the piston’s up
and down motion into circular motion. It is usually the crankshaft that converts
the linear motion of the pistons into rotational motion since the car’s wheels
motion is also rotational. Because of this function that the crankshaft does,
it is likely to fail after some time, but this can very well be prevented through
the use of a BMW harmonic balancer.

The BMW harmonic balancer is used to prevent crankshaft failure as it lessens
harmonic vibration. Harmonic vibration usually occurs when a halfway twisted shaft
unwinds and snaps back in the opposite direction. The harmonic balancer is also
called as a vibration damper and is connected to the crankshaft. It is made up
of three parts which include the inner part which is bolted to the crankshaft,
the center part which is a rubber ring that dampens crankshaft vibrations, and
the outer part with the timing marks and pulley cuts for the belts.
